摘要
A 2-year field experiment was conducted with wheat (Triticum aestivum L. emend. Fiori & Paol.) variety 'HD 2285' in semi-reclaimed sodic soil of Karnal, comprising 4 levels each of nitrogen and irrigation. Scheduling irrigation at 1.2 irrigation water: cumulative pan evaporation (IW : CPE) ratio was better than other irrigation schedules in terms of grain yield. With each increment of N level from 60 to 180 kg/ha, there was a significant increase in the grain yield as well as N uptake. Response to N of grain production at 1.2 IW : CPE ratio was significantly more than that at 0.6 and 0.9 IW : CPE ratios. The N content in shoot at spike-initiation stage was higher in irrigated than in unirrigated treatment, but reverse was true for N content in grain and straw at maturity. The N uptake through grain and straw was higher when irrigation was given at 1.2 IW : CPE ratio. Recovery of applied N and N-use efficiency were maximum when irrigation was given at 1.2 IW : CPE ratio along with 60 kg N/ha.
